Understanding High-Drain Applications

High-drain applications, such as advanced electronics, medical devices, and power tools, require batteries that can handle large amounts of energy output over a short period. These devices demand high performance, which standard batteries may struggle to provide consistently.

Comparing with Custom Lithium-Ion Polymer Batteries

While custom lithium ion polymer batteries are another excellent option for high-drain applications, they differ from lithium primary batteries in their recharging capabilities. Lithium-ion batteries are rechargeable, which can be advantageous for applications requiring frequent power cycling. However, for single-use scenarios where recharging is not an option, custom lithium primary battery packs offer a reliable and efficient solution.
